I would always recommend a professional, because otherwise I would be doing myself out of a job, but also they will achieve the best results in the most sympathetic manner - caveat to say this is the case if you use a specialist, experienced company. Be warned there are a lot of cowboys out there. A pro detailer will also recommend and apply a good quality wax or sealant on completion to protect the finish.

That said, its your car so why not have a go yourself. You would need a machine such as a DAS 6 Pro and a selection of compounds, polishes and sealsnts to do the job properly but bear in mind that purchasing the kit will probably cost a large proportion of the price charged by a Pro to do it...
